The oxo alcohol market exhibits a dynamic competitive landscape characterized by a blend of innovation, strategic partnerships, and regional expansion. Key players such as BASF SE (DE), ExxonMobil Chemical (US), and Eastman Chemical Company (US) are actively shaping the market through their distinct operational focuses. BASF SE (DE) emphasizes sustainability and innovation, investing in advanced production technologies to enhance efficiency and reduce environmental impact. ExxonMobil Chemical (US) leverages its extensive supply chain capabilities to optimize production and distribution, while Eastman Chemical Company (US) focuses on diversifying its product portfolio to meet evolving customer demands. Collectively, these strategies contribute to a competitive environment that is increasingly driven by technological advancements and sustainability initiatives.In terms of business tactics, companies are localizing manufacturing to better serve regional markets and optimize supply chains. The market structure appears moderately fragmented, with several key players exerting influence over pricing and product availability. This fragmentation allows for niche players to emerge, yet the collective strength of major companies like Dow Inc. (US) and SABIC (SA) ensures that competition remains robust. The strategic maneuvers of these companies are pivotal in shaping market dynamics, as they seek to enhance their operational efficiencies and market reach.
In October Dow Inc. (US) announced a significant investment in a new production facility aimed at increasing its capacity for producing oxo alcohols. This strategic move is likely to bolster Dow's market position by enhancing its ability to meet growing demand, particularly in the automotive and construction sectors. The investment underscores Dow's commitment to innovation and capacity expansion, which may provide a competitive edge in a rapidly evolving market.
In September Eastman Chemical Company (US) launched a new line of sustainable oxo alcohols derived from renewable resources. This initiative not only aligns with global sustainability trends but also positions Eastman as a leader in eco-friendly chemical solutions. The introduction of these products could attract environmentally conscious consumers and businesses, thereby enhancing Eastman's market share and reputation.
In August ExxonMobil Chemical (US) entered into a strategic partnership with a leading technology firm to develop advanced digital solutions for its production processes. This collaboration aims to integrate AI and machine learning into manufacturing operations, potentially increasing efficiency and reducing costs. Such technological advancements may redefine operational standards within the industry, allowing ExxonMobil to maintain a competitive advantage.
